当前位置:首页 > nginx > 正文

nginx简单配置举例

  • nginx
  • 2024-05-04 07:21:36
  • 2815

Nginx 是一个高性能的 Web 服务器,以其速度、稳定性和可扩展性而闻名。 以下是 Nginx 一个简单的配置示例:
# Nginx 配置文件
server {
listen 80;
# 网站根目录
root /var/www/html;
# 索引页面
index index.html index.htm;
# 错误页面
error_page 404 /404.html;
error_page 500 /500.html;
# HTTP 请求的日志记录
access_log /var/log/nginx/access.log;
error_log /var/log/nginx/error.log;
}
配置说明:
listen 80;:指定 Nginx 在端口 80 上监听传入的 HTTP 请求。
root /var/www/html;:指定网站的根目录,即存储 Web 页面的目录。
index index.html index.htm;:指定服务器在目录中找不到特定文件时要显示的默认索引页面。
error_page 404 /404.html; error_page 500 /500.html;:指定自定义的 404(未找到)和 500(内部服务器错误)错误页面。
access_log /var/log/nginx/access.log; error_log /var/log/nginx/error.log;:指定访问和错误日志文件的路径。
注意事项:
确保已将 Nginx 配置文件保存在正确的路径中,通常为 /etc/nginx/nginx.conf 或 /usr/local/etc/nginx/nginx.conf。
在重新加载配置之前,请使用 nginx -t 命令检查配置是否存在语法错误。
Nginx 的配置非常灵活,可以针对各种场景进行自定义。 有关更多详细信息,请参阅官方文档。